Dermatofibroma Treatment The particular tethering of the superior skin to the underlying sore with side compression (pinching), called the dimple sign, might be a beneficial medical sign for diagnosis. Nevertheless, the existence of the dimple sign does not constantly confirm that the lesion is dermatofibroma, and dermatoscopy might be useful in sustaining the clinical impression. Dermatofibroma-- additionally referred to as benign coarse histiocytoma-- is a slow-growing, benign skin nodule that get more info typically creates on the reduced legs. Dermatofibromas happen in grownups of every ages but are a lot more typical in ladies than men. Atrophic variations of dermatofibroma might occur in about two percent of situations. They might be taken into consideration the 'burnt-out' or terminal stage of the typical fibrous histiocytoma. They are usually discovered on the upper trunk and extremities, in middle aged women, and dimpling is classically existing.

Cryotherapy, shave biopsy and laser treatments are seldom entirely effective. Analysis excision or skin biopsy is taken on if there is an atypical feature such as recent augmentation, ulceration, or asymmetrical frameworks and colours on dermoscopy.
